CI note for the weekly sync: the Dunharrow secrets-rotation utility intermittently fails its smoke test when the vault emulator starts slower than the client timeout. Workaround is the retry wrapper added in the pipeline config; a proper readiness probe is in review. No production rotations were affected. If you see the failure locally, rerun once before filing. Repro and logs were captured against the build identified below.

pipeline stamp: htk9_ce63042d9

Build provenance — Sweepline retention sweeper. Each sweeper release is built on the Garnet runner from a signed tag; artifacts carry an attestation linking commit, runner image, and policy version. No manual builds permitted since the Oakhollow incident. For the sync: last week's run deleted 1.2M expired records, zero policy mismatches. Verify any deployed binary against the provenance token shown below.

trace token, fafog-kageg: htk4_98e6

= Large-Deal Discount Policy (Restricted) =

Quick refresher for the board: any deal above the enterprise threshold now needs two sign-offs — the regional lead plus someone from the Revarra pricing desk. Standard discounts top out at 18%; anything beyond that goes to committee. We've been burned before by creative bundling (looking at you, Q2), so the policy closes those gaps. Reps get trained next month. The rationale ties into the note that follows.

board note of baweg-bawig: Project Tamath slips by six weeks because of the audit delay.

## Tailing logs with `vex-tail`

Use `vex-tail` for all service log streams. Do not SSH into nodes directly.

Basics:
- `vex-tail --svc payments --env staging` streams live.
- Add `--since 15m` for recent history.
- `--grep` filters server-side; prefer it over piping.

If the stream stalls, restart the session before filing a ticket with the Platform crew.

For audit queries against the log archive, connect using the following string.

primary connection of yagep-kahip = redis://giliel_svc:zYiKsLL2PLpfPL@db-348f.xolmarsys.corp:5432/fenwyn